‘Carte’ has been completed in June 2023 in the new Belvédère district of Bordeaux, France.
The installation comprises 14 cast aluminium trees with a moulded texture resembling real Landes pine trees, giving the piece a realistic appearance. The trees support a 40 mm thick aluminium canopy with cut-outs made with a water jet cutting technique, accurately portraying the ‘Port of the Moon city plan.
We supported the teams of Leandro Erlich Studio for Fonds Cré'Atlantique in structural engineering, parametric optimisation of the structures, and the necessary realisation of the canopy plan.
